Here are a few keyboard shortcuts Available in Windows 7:
Win+UP Arrow | Maximize the current window
Win+Down Arrow | If the current window is maximized, restore it; if the current window is restored, minimize it
Win+Up | Maximize Window
Win+Down | Minimize Window
Win+Left | Snap Window to left
Win+Right | Snap Window to right
Win+Shift+Left | Jump to left monitor
Win+Shift+Right | Jump to right monitor
Win+Home | Minimize / Restore all other windows
Win+T | Focus the first taskbar entry, similar to ALT +TAB
Win+Shift+T | Same as above in reverse order
Win+Space | Peek at the desktop
Win+G | Bring Gadgets to the top
Win+ [Num] | Launches the numbered app running in the Super bar
Win+P | Connecting displays to computers and switching from single monitor to dual|display
Win+X | Mobility Center
Win + + | Zoom in and out of Windows
Win + | Zoom in and out of Windows
ALT+P. | Show/hide Preview Pane in Explorer
Win + Tab | Windows Aero Task Switcher
Shift + Click on icon (Taskbar) | Open a new instance
Middle click on icon(Taskbar) | Open a new instance
Ctrl + Shift + Click on icon (Taskbar) | Open a new instance with Admin privileges
Shift + Right|click on icon (Taskbar) | Show window menu (Restore / Minimize / Move / etc)
Shift + Right|click on grouped icon (Taskbar) | Menu with Restore All / Minimize All / Close All, etc.
Ctrl + Click on grouped icon | Cycle between the windows (or tabs) in the group
We show you at the beginning of the month how they Personalize the menu "Send to" in Windows Vista. Is the option that will allow you to Copy / send a file or folder from one location to another by a simple click-right.
Screenshot “Send To” in Windows Vista :
As you can see in the image above, the destinations offered in Windows XP and Windows Vista are not many. Nor in Windows 7 would not be more…
..but if Keep Press Shift key While giving click-right On the file/folder you will notice that the number of destinations to which you can selected file or folder is much larger…
I do not really realize how I could send the "Smart" folder (taken as a guinea pig) on fax or in putty.exe, but we must understand that Windows 7 is currently in a beta development stage. :)
Ah..and in the image above you can see two new options that have appeared when I used the combination Shift + click-right.
Copy as Path – Copy the location (the way) file or the folder pe hdd. In the case of the example above, the Smart folder is on the desktop. After I gave "Copy AS Path", I was saved in the clipboard “W:UsersStealth SettingsDesktopSMART”
Open in New Process -opens the contents of the folder in a new process. (eg explorer.exe). This novelty is very important in Administration of system resources.
